What is Network Marketing also known as MLM
and how does it work?
Network Marketing also referred to as MLM is a form of marketing in which sales associates receive compensation, not only for personal sales but also for the sales of team members whom they have recruited. This can sometimes create a downline of distributors and a hierarchy with multiple levels of compensation. Typically, salespeople create relationship referrals and word-of-mouth marketing to conduct and expand businesses.
The idea is simple, instead of spending money on professional marketing and ad agencies, to promote a product or service, why not pay the people who love them the most have them promote it by sharing it with others? This is exactly what a network marketing company does, they pay a portion of each sales dollar received back out to their independent distributors that share and promote their product or service. These independent distributors are usually the products most committed and enthusiastic consumers.
MLM was introduced in 1945 by the California Vitamin Company, later known as Nutrilite. The Direct Selling Association, of which about 200 companies are members, defines direct selling as “the sale of a consumer product or service, person-to-person, away from a fixed retail location, marketed through independent sales representatives.”
According to the DSA, an enormous variety of products and services are available for purchase through this business model, although direct selling is frequently associated with items such as greeting cards, cosmetics and wellness products.

Support for MLM
While the basics of MLM are fairly straightforward, Kiyosaki is supports the business model, because he believes MLM directly generates wealth.
“Even more important than the quantity of money you make is the quality of money you make,” Kiyosaki wrote.
This is explained by examining a cashflow quadrant chart below, which is comprised of four distinct sources of income.
The “E quadrant,” which represents the employed, is one in which most people reside. This is often considered to be the most accepted way of earning income.
However, according to Kiyosaki, job security is a thing of the past. Therefore, those in the “employed” mindset will never achieve true financial freedom, because they will always work for someone else. In other words, workers only get paid if and when they go to work.
The “S quadrant” represents those who are self-employed and small-business owners. This includes a range of occupations, from freelancers to doctors, real estate agents, insurance agents, and attorneys. Kiyosaki references a poll conducted by the Fresno research firm Decipher that found, “Seventy-two percent of all adult Americans would rather work for themselves than for a job, and 67 percent think about quitting their jobs regularly.”
According to Kiyosaki, while this quadrant can be financially rewarding, it frequently binds business owners with extreme time commitments.
The “I quadrant” includes a very small percentage of the population; those who make the majority of their income through investments.
According to Kiyosaki, the “B quadrant”, which represents big-business owners, is the only way to create genuine wealth.
“Wealth is not the same thing as money,” he wrote. “Wealth is not measured by the size of income. Wealth is measured in time.”
By creating a team of workers, a business owner can create assets. Assets generate passive income, the type of income truly wealthy people typically have. Whether or not a big-business owner works on any given day, the owner still generates income, because of team efforts.
According to Kiyosaki, one of the greatest benefits of the MLM business model is the ability it provides for individuals to move into the B quadrant. All associates in legitimate MLM companies, regardless of level or position, are able to hire a team of workers, which provides the potential for enormous financial growth.
